question text To ask the Secretary of State for Northern Ireland, if he will bring forward legislative proposals to require the publication of details of electoral donations received by political parties in Northern Ireland between 2014 and 2017. more like this

answer text <p>The Transparency of Donations and Loans etc. (Northern Ireland Political Parties) Order 2018 introduced transparency around donations and loans to political parties in Northern Ireland from July 2017. The date set in the legislation for introduction of the transparency regime followed a consultation process and represented a broad consensus across the Northern Ireland political parties.</p><p> </p><p>The Government has no plans in place to legislate to facilitate the publication of pre-2017 data. We are committed to undertaking an operational review to consider all aspects of the operation of the donation and loans systems in Northern Ireland, to review whether there might be a case for further reforms.</p><p> </p><p> </p> more like this

question text To ask the Secretary of State for the Home Department, what the process is for the reimbursement of fees paid by non-UK EU nationals for applications for settled status; and how that process will be communicated to those non-UK EU nationals. more like this

answer text <p>As the Prime Minister announced on 21 January anyone who has already applied for settled status under the EU Settlement Scheme, or who applies and pays a fee during the pilot phases, will have their fee refunded.</p><p>The Home Office will set out full details in due course.</p> more like this
